Output 56e8ac23478713f371a28eb5a475b04c62f3793b9cec451f01975a45493e30bb:5

value
270429958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cfbd163cfab339b72944b5b9a055a6632f58b0 OP_EQUAL
address
MSJEuvLq2PghpDEv6gKepXCbvx5zGqFeTA
transaction
56e8ac23478713f371a28eb5a475b04c62f3793b9cec451f01975a45493e30bb
spent
true